Katlu
Katlu is a village located in Ramshahr tehsil of Solan district in Himachal Pradesh, India. It is situated 90km away from district headquarter Ramshahr. Ramshahr is the sub-district headquarter of Katlu village. As per 2009 stats, Baila is the gram panchayat of Katlu village.

About Katlu
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Katlu is 020652. The village spans a total geographical area of 81 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 173219. Nalagarh is nearest town to Katlu village for all major economic activities.
When it comes to local governance, Katlu village is administered by a Sarpanch, the elected head of the village, in accordance with the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. The village falls under the Arki Vidhan Sabha constituency for state-level representation and the Shimla Lok Sabha constituency for national parliamentary elections. Population of Katlu
Below is a concise population overview of Katlu as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 45 | 25 | 20 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 1 | N/A | 1 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 45 | 25 | 20 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Literate Population | 30 | 20 | 10 |
Illiterate Population | 15 | 5 | 10 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Katlu village:
- The total population of Katlu village is around 45, including approximately 25 males and 20 females, with a sex ratio of 800 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 1 children aged 0–6 years in Katlu village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Katlu village has 45 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
- The literacy rate of Katlu village is about 66.67%, with male literacy at 80.00% and female literacy at 50.00%.
- There are around 9 households in Katlu village.
Connectivity of Katlu
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Katlu. As per the 2011 stats, Katlu had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
